# RotateRectAt Method

Summary

Syntax

C#
VB
Java
Objective-C
WinRT C#
C++
````public static LeadRectD RotateRectAt( `
`   LeadRectD rect, `
`   double angle, `
`   double centerX, `
`   double centerY `
`) ````
````Public Shared Function RotateRectAt( _ `
`   ByVal rect As Leadtools.LeadRectD, _ `
`   ByVal angle As Double, _ `
`   ByVal centerX As Double, _ `
`   ByVal centerY As Double _ `
`) As Leadtools.LeadRectD ````
````public static Leadtools.LeadRectD RotateRectAt(  `
`   Leadtools.LeadRectD rect, `
`   double angle, `
`   double centerX, `
`   double centerY `
`) ````
````+(LeadRectD) rotateRect:(LeadRectD) rect  `
`                  angle:(double) angle `
`                centerX:(double) cx `
`                centerY:(double) cy; `
`             ````
````public static LeadRectD rotateRectAt( `
`   LeadRectD rect, `
`   double angle, `
`   double centerX, `
`   double centerY `
`) `
`             ````
```` function Leadtools.Annotations.Core.AnnTransformer.RotateRectAt(  `
`   rect , `
`   angle , `
`   centerX , `
`   centerY  `
`) ````
````public:  `
`   static LeadRectD^ RotateRectAt( `
`      LeadRectD^ rect, `
`      double angle, `
`      double centerX, `
`      double centerY `
`   ) ````

#### Parameters

rect

angle

centerX
The value representing the center point of rotation on the x-axis.

centerY
The value representing the center point of rotation on the y-axis.

Requirements

Target Platforms